West Old Country Road [1-19-15]
In the late night hours of Monday, January 19th, 2015 the Hicksville Fire Department was dispatched to a report of a building fire at 400 West Old Country Road [Chief Equipment]. When units arrived on scene they were met with smoke showing from a one story commercial building containing lawn mowers and other power equipment inside. As firefighters made their way into the building they found a heavy smoke condition throughout the showroom but were unable to locate the source of the smoke. As firefighters continued their search Hicksville Command inquired from dispatch the particulars on the building including what the roof was made of. Once the answers were provided a FAST was requested to the scene. Westbury Ladder 962 responded in accordance with this request. After a few minutes firefighters located the fire – an isolated pile of contents in the rear section of the building. Among the contents were batteries and other potentially hazardous materials. Because of this Nassau County HazMat was requested to the scene. Hicksville Engine 937, positioned along the number two side of the building, had two lines stretched with one line in operation. All fire department units were under the command of Hicksville Chief of Department McGeough [9301].
